Should You Buy Or Adopt a Pet?
If you are looking to add a pet to your home, think about adopting an animal shelter or rescue group. This is much cheaper than buying from a pet breeder or store.
Adopting a pet is a truly satisfying experience. You can learn about your pet's past and receive assistance throughout the initial phase of familiarization.
1. Save a life
Millions of abandoned, stray and lost animals end up in shelters every year, with many euthanized because of overpopulation. By adopting a pet you are directly saving the life of that animal. Additionally, when you adopt, you make space for another animal who is homeless in the shelter, thereby saving a number of lives through one compassionate act.
Adopting a pet will prevent the euthanasia every year of millions of loving and healthy animals. A lot of these pets are killed due to a space shortages in overcrowded shelters and the number of euthanized animals could be drastically reduced by a greater number of people considering adopting instead of buying the pet from breeders. Adopting a pet isn't just an excellent option to find the perfect pet, but it is also a wonderful way to help save the lives of a lot of other animals. It's a win-win situation for everyone!
